Scotland 260 for 4 (102 Mommsen, Coetzer 56) and 350 (102 Flannigan, Viljoen 3-71) v Namibia 263 (Williams 51, Haq 6-32)
Scorecard
A career-best 6-32 in-offspinner Majid Haq, a century by Preston Mommsen and 1 / 52 of the game for Kyle Coetzer has helped Scotland to build almost an impenetrable 347-run lead with six wickets left at the third day of their Intercontinental Cup match against Namibia.
